Several factors are propelling the growth of the polyester geotextiles market. Firstly, the burgeoning global construction industry, especially in developing nations, is a major driver. Massive infrastructure projects, including road construction, railway expansion, and large-scale building projects, require substantial quantities of geotextiles for soil stabilization, drainage, and erosion control. The inherent properties of polyester geotextiles, such as their high tensile strength, excellent filtration capabilities, and resistance to UV degradation and microbial attack, make them highly suitable for these applications. Secondly, the growing focus on sustainable infrastructure development is driving demand for eco-friendly construction materials. Polyester geotextiles, being recyclable and exhibiting a longer lifespan compared to some alternatives, fit this criteria perfectly. Government initiatives promoting sustainable practices in the construction sector are further stimulating market growth. Thirdly, technological advancements in manufacturing processes have led to the production of high-performance geotextiles with improved properties, such as enhanced strength, durability, and permeability. This continuous innovation is catering to increasingly demanding application requirements and pushing the boundaries of performance capabilities. Lastly, favorable government regulations and policies supporting sustainable construction and infrastructure projects are further encouraging the widespread adoption of polyester geotextiles across various sectors.
Despite the positive growth outlook, the polyester geotextiles market faces several challenges. F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ly polyester yarn, pose a significant threat to market stability. Increases in raw material costs can directly impact the production cost of geotextiles, leading to price hikes and reduced market competitiveness. Furthermore, intense competition from other geotextile materials, such as polypropylene and polyethylene, presents a challenge. These alternatives often offer competitive pricing, impacting the market share of polyester geotextiles. The market is also subject to regional variations in demand, requiring manufacturers to adjust their production strategies and distribution networks to effectively cater to differing market needs. Finally, the potential environmental impact associated with the production and disposal of polyester geotextiles needs careful consideration. Though recyclable, concerns surrounding the environmental footprint associated with polyester production are emerging, potentially affecting the overall perception of the material and its adoption.
The Asia-Pacific region is projected to dominate the polyester geotextiles market throughout the forecast period. This dominance stems from the region's rapid infrastructure development, driven by significant investments in construction projects across various sectors, including roads, railways, and urban development initiatives. Countries such as China and India are experiencing substantial growth in infrastructure spending, significantly boosting demand for geotextiles. Within the Asia-Pacific region, China is expected to lead, driven by its massive investments in infrastructure modernization.
In terms of segments, the construction sector is the largest consumer of polyester geotextiles. Its significant role in infrastructure development projects, including road construction, railways, and other land-development projects, translates to substantial geotextile demand.
